The coil embolization for cerebral aneurysm is one of the effective treatments. However, sometimes blood flow may induce recanalization or growth of the aneurysm. Therefore, the measurements of flow speed with coils in aneurysm are necessary for analyzing the effect of coil on the flow in the aneurysm. However, the method for quantitative measurement using an optical image based velocimetry such as PIV has not been established because coil makes shades in flow field. In this study, we tried to identify the shades by coils and the traces by particles by superimposing consecutive images. Several parts of coils are placed on out of aneurysm cavity and it placement may induce that the speed in inflow zone with coils is larger than that of no coil model. These results will clarify the relationship between coil formation at the neck and the flow in aneurysm.
